
Aardvark diet
A shy, elusive creature, the aardvark exists on a diet of ants and termites. The males can grow to weigh as much as a fully grown man, feeding entirely on the huge numbers of these insects that live on the savannah. Termite nests can be far apart and it can take an aardvark up to an hour to find one, but they'll go to great lengths to find them as they need to eat in the region of 100,000 of these insects every night.
